Jenny Johnson at the SFM

Co-host and Executive Producer of TV Diner, Jenny Johnson will stop by the Salem Farmers’ Market Thursday, August 26 at 4:00 p.m. to join the cooking demonstration by Executive Chef & Owner of 62 Restaurant & Winebar in Salem, MA, Antonio Bettencourt.  Commissioner Scott Soares DAR and Commissioner Julia Kehoe DTA will also participate in the cooking demonstration and a special event at the market.  Mayor Kimberley Driscoll and State Representative John Keenan will officiate the special event. The market is held in Derby Square on Front Street in downtown Salem from 3 – 7 p.m. every Thursday through October 21. Salem, A Great Place To Live

The resident survey is in and 90% would recommend Salem as a place to live. To see what about 1,000 Salem residents said about the city and how it is managed visit Salem.com to read the survey results.  With so many great events year round, businesses and attractions it is no surprise Salem residents love their city.
